Understanding AI OptimizationImage by Peter Burdon

Understanding AI Optimization

Introduction to AI Optimization

AI optimization refers to the set of techniques and processes employed to enhance the performance and efficiency of artificial intelligence systems. This involves fine-tuning AI algorithms and models to achieve optimal results in various applications, from industrial automation to personalised user experiences.

Techniques in AI Optimization

There are several techniques used in AI optimization, including gradient descent, genetic algorithms, and reinforcement learning. Gradient descent involves finding the minimum of a function by iteratively moving towards the lowest point. Genetic algorithms simulate the process of natural selection to generate high-quality solutions for optimization problems. Reinforcement learning, on the other hand, is an approach where an AI learns to make decisions by receiving rewards or penalties for the actions it takes.

Applications of AI Optimization

AI optimization is pivotal in various industries. In the manufacturing sector, it's used to enhance production efficiency and reduce waste. In finance, AI optimization helps in algorithmic trading, allowing for rapid analysis and decision-making. Healthcare benefits from AI optimization through improved diagnostics and treatment plans. Moreover, it plays a crucial role in logistics and supply chain management by optimizing routes and inventory levels.

Challenges in AI Optimization

Despite its benefits, AI optimization faces several challenges. These include the high computational power required and the complexity of creating models that can generalise effectively across different scenarios. Furthermore, ethical considerations, such as data privacy and algorithmic bias, pose significant challenges that must be addressed.

Pros & Cons

Pros

  • Improves operational efficiency
  • Enhances decision-making processes
  • Reduces costs in various sectors

Cons

  • Requires significant computational resources
  • May lead to algorithmic bias if not properly managed
  • Challenges in maintaining data privacy

Step-by-Step

  1. 1

    Determine the primary goal of optimization, whether it's reducing costs, improving accuracy, or enhancing user experience.

  2. 2

    Choose the suitable optimization algorithms based on the specific problem and constraints. Popular choices include gradient descent and genetic algorithms.

  3. 3

    Use datasets to train the AI model, ensuring that it learns effectively and achieves the desired outcomes.

  4. 4

    Continuously evaluate the model's performance and iterate on the process. Adjust parameters and techniques as needed to achieve optimum results.

FAQs

What is the primary goal of AI optimization?

The primary goal of AI optimization is to enhance the performance and efficiency of AI systems to achieve optimal results in specific applications.

Can AI optimization be applied across all industries?

Yes, AI optimization is versatile and can be applied in various industries, including manufacturing, finance, healthcare, and logistics, among others.

Enhance Your Systems with AI Optimization

Leverage AI optimization to take your business processes to the next level. Discover how our solutions can transform efficiency and drive success across your organisation.

Learn More

Related Pages